Arthur Schiwon
|
c48157e3b8
|
LDAP: don't validate unconfigured (new) LDAP server configs, fixes #5518
|
2013-10-24 20:26:05 +02:00 |
Arthur Schiwon
|
20f46602bd
|
LDAP: when multiline values are passed as array, do not try to preg_split them. Fixes #5521
|
2013-10-24 14:27:33 +02:00 |
Arthur Schiwon
|
6284e95e2b
|
typo, fixes #5517
|
2013-10-24 14:16:58 +02:00 |
Arthur Schiwon
|
30c0f5dee6
|
LDAP Wizard: proper strings and translations for user and group count text
|
2013-10-23 12:20:13 +02:00 |
Arthur Schiwon
|
d78a80a689
|
merge master with resolved conflicts
|
2013-10-23 12:01:45 +02:00 |
Arthur Schiwon
|
e61d961efb
|
LDAP: Fix base-comparison with multibyte characters, fixes #5081. Thanks to @sfyang
|
2013-10-19 00:51:37 +02:00 |
Arthur Schiwon
|
17010e8f58
|
Don't set Base User and Base Group when Base DN was detected, would case problems but does not provide any benefit. also make sure that empty string is saved instead of false for multiline values
|
2013-10-17 20:58:43 +02:00 |
Arthur Schiwon
|
6acd01d9f2
|
resolve merge conflicts from rebase
|
2013-10-17 19:40:59 +02:00 |
Arthur Schiwon
|
f64ae75107
|
LDAP Wizard: fix couple more or less nasty bugs aka polishing
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
109ddde944
|
Wizard: autodetection of group-member-assoc attribute
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
5606b60f36
|
LDAP: set displayname as default attribute for user display name
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
b2ccb712e2
|
Ldap Wizard: Group Filter configuration
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
7c6a9c2256
|
Ldap Wizard: Login filter UI, detection of username attribute, composing of login filter
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
e903db7887
|
LDAP Wizard: create user list filter, show number of user that will have access to OC
|
2013-10-17 19:13:28 +02:00 |
Arthur Schiwon
|
5c99645f7d
|
Cleanup code, sort results
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
162bfb231a
|
Ldap Wizard: find out whether server supports memberOf in LDAP Filter and disable group chooser if not
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
e87b091536
|
cleanup and coding style
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
87bd5a2bbb
|
cleanup, doc and todo
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
3cafcc2d47
|
LDAP Wizard: add detection, load and save of LDAP groups for filter purposes
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
5425511259
|
Remove debug output
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
3b1822cf91
|
LDAP Wizard: add detection, load and save of LDAP objectClasses for filter purposes
|
2013-10-17 19:13:27 +02:00 |
Arthur Schiwon
|
8290929aa6
|
LDAP Wizard: autodetect base DN
|
2013-10-17 19:13:14 +02:00 |
Arthur Schiwon
|
7c60384f20
|
ignore autodetect-attribute on public save method
|
2013-10-17 19:13:14 +02:00 |
Arthur Schiwon
|
3fe400a3ca
|
Simplify WizardResult
|
2013-10-17 19:13:14 +02:00 |
Arthur Schiwon
|
53db1fe5ac
|
First stage of new Wizard, neither feature complete nor ready
|
2013-10-17 19:13:14 +02:00 |
Arthur Schiwon
|
652caa1c88
|
LDAP: move Configuration out of Connection into class of its own. The new wizard requires it.
|
2013-10-17 19:13:14 +02:00 |
Arthur Schiwon
|
02f292d0fd
|
Doc fix
|
2013-10-17 19:01:08 +02:00 |
Arthur Schiwon
|
0c837cefb6
|
LDAP: allow different UUID attributes for groups and users
|
2013-10-04 11:47:40 +02:00 |
Arthur Schiwon
|
a1aff3e8a1
|
LDAP: don't throw exceptions in the wrapper, errors are handled in the code. nevertheless, log unexpected errors
|
2013-09-27 13:34:16 +02:00 |
Arthur Schiwon
|
81cf4a22ef
|
LDAP: coding style
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
bb162b1f94
|
LDAP: get rid of some PHP Warnings
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
d4f92494a2
|
LDAP: make Access be a dependency to the user and group backend instead of inheriting it.
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
f04aa1af5d
|
LDAP: don't check var type when you can specify the type in the parameter list
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
b9cd22cf78
|
LDAP: use wrapper, not direct function call
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
5090ca3eb4
|
LDAP: add phpdoc
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
6e850e0bee
|
LDAP: establish wrapper interface to allow proper mocking
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
52454e39b7
|
LDAP: move is_resource check to ldap wrapper to make it mockable
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
d34fbf3a86
|
LDAP: move PHP LDAP functions calls to an LDAP Wrapper for better isolation and mock testing
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
1a020e0696
|
Resolve merge conflict
|
2013-09-27 13:34:15 +02:00 |
Arthur Schiwon
|
321c514782
|
LDAP: case insensitive replace for more robustness
|
2013-08-27 22:23:48 +02:00 |
Arthur Schiwon
|
c482512e23
|
LDAP: fix wrong hook name
|
2013-08-22 00:00:33 +02:00 |
Kondou
|
c7af26ec84
|
Merge pull request #4497 from owncloud/newlines_at_eof_kondou
Add newlines at the end of files
|
2013-08-18 07:16:15 -07:00 |
Bart Visscher
|
dda5eb2530
|
Merge pull request #4486 from owncloud/ldap_adjust_cache
LDAP: use memcache if available
|
2013-08-18 02:50:41 -07:00 |
kondou
|
9e8a6b704d
|
Add _many_ newlines at the end of files
|
2013-08-18 11:06:59 +02:00 |
Jan-Christoph Borchardt
|
ce9103d522
|
Merge pull request #4426 from owncloud/ldap_settings_design
Ldap settings design
|
2013-08-18 01:52:51 -07:00 |
Arthur Schiwon
|
f41c4312ff
|
LDAP: use memcache if available
|
2013-08-17 17:22:54 +02:00 |
Arthur Schiwon
|
c538ac3081
|
LDAP: only connect to LDAP once on login
|
2013-08-17 12:16:51 +02:00 |
Arthur Schiwon
|
479f893f6d
|
LDAP: Show Host name in configuration drop down
|
2013-08-15 15:55:06 +02:00 |
Arthur Schiwon
|
f6d133955e
|
LDAP: fix background job, resolves #3528
|
2013-07-19 18:41:29 +02:00 |
Arthur Schiwon
|
5387e5c354
|
LDAP: even better check for emptiness, fixes #3815
|
2013-07-10 11:39:47 +02:00 |
Jörn Friedrich Dreyer
|
88fc410c19
|
fix numRows usage in user_ldap
|
2013-06-24 16:29:58 +02:00 |
Arthur Schiwon
|
4976f2e0d3
|
LDAP: append port when URL is passed in LDAP Host configuration, fixes #2600
|
2013-06-04 10:32:54 +02:00 |
Robin Appelman
|
251527c6e6
|
merge master into backgroundjob
|
2013-06-02 20:12:44 +02:00 |
blizzz
|
1656cc2e7c
|
Merge pull request #3565 from owncloud/fix_ldap_sqlite_n_js
Fix ldap sqlite n js
|
2013-05-31 12:17:46 -07:00 |
blizzz
|
eafb241068
|
Merge pull request #3562 from owncloud/fix_ldap_offline_host_handling
Fix ldap offline host handling
|
2013-05-31 11:10:33 -07:00 |
Arthur Schiwon
|
2ff9677cd1
|
LDAP: sqlite compatibility for emptyiing tables
|
2013-05-31 20:07:13 +02:00 |
Arthur Schiwon
|
bd7771867b
|
LDAP: fix generation of alternate internal name on conflicts. Use also smaller number for better user experience on e.g. *DAV links
|
2013-05-30 16:55:21 +02:00 |
Arthur Schiwon
|
86d72b9a61
|
LDAP: fix possible recursion
|
2013-05-25 11:03:58 +02:00 |
Arthur Schiwon
|
bfa715768a
|
LDAP: fix handling when LDAP Host is offline
|
2013-05-25 11:02:51 +02:00 |
Arthur Schiwon
|
beaa10b823
|
Merge branch 'master' into ldap_configurable_username_n_uuid
|
2013-05-13 12:41:22 +02:00 |
Arthur Schiwon
|
796ee8c4c0
|
LDAP: Implement clear mappings functionality
|
2013-05-08 17:47:07 +02:00 |
Arthur Schiwon
|
3f1717d3d5
|
LDAP: implement UUID and internal username override
|
2013-05-08 14:56:52 +02:00 |
Arthur Schiwon
|
c9b3da5bbc
|
LDAP: better variable name
|
2013-05-08 14:55:56 +02:00 |
Arthur Schiwon
|
bc23010670
|
LDAP: implement r+w for new settings
|
2013-05-08 14:05:08 +02:00 |
Bart Visscher
|
175633d380
|
Merge pull request #3050 from owncloud/===_and_!==_in_user_ldap-app
Use === and !== in user_ldap app
|
2013-05-07 12:45:43 -07:00 |
Arthur Schiwon
|
d659d8e193
|
LDAP: do not reset UUID attribute setting when guid is detected
|
2013-05-06 10:17:52 +02:00 |
Arthur Schiwon
|
1e2b872160
|
LDAP: cachekey in set method needs to match with that one from get
|
2013-05-03 15:13:37 +02:00 |
Arthur Schiwon
|
22a8e7ad55
|
LDAP: remove restriction from group names to be in line with core behaviour again
|
2013-05-03 14:11:06 +02:00 |
Robin Appelman
|
7948341a86
|
Rework background job system
|
2013-04-20 23:27:46 +02:00 |
kondou
|
d6b13ccd12
|
Use !== and === in user_ldap app – Part 2
|
2013-04-20 22:46:37 +02:00 |
Arthur Schiwon
|
0f4e02b6fc
|
LDAP: avoid irritating log output
|
2013-03-19 14:40:30 +01:00 |
Arthur Schiwon
|
504f5f229f
|
LDAP: remove unnecessary func call, was a leftover from earlier refactor
|
2013-03-19 14:40:05 +01:00 |
Arthur Schiwon
|
f38932fb80
|
LDAP: specify appid when selecting from appconfig
|
2013-03-19 14:39:56 +01:00 |
Arthur Schiwon
|
1e07801c95
|
LDAP: compatibility with Novell eDirectory UUID
|
2013-03-11 13:30:06 +01:00 |
Arthur Schiwon
|
055fadd10d
|
LDAP: escape some more chars for proper search filter, fixes #1673
|
2013-03-05 14:33:20 +01:00 |
Arthur Schiwon
|
b08894ba77
|
LDAP: error codes can be negative, too
|
2013-03-05 13:47:03 +01:00 |
Brice Maron
|
dbb9b68331
|
Fix quoting of query for user_ldap ref #1983
|
2013-03-02 16:26:15 +01:00 |
Arthur Schiwon
|
64551ee06f
|
LDAP: sort users on server-side
|
2013-02-26 22:27:09 +01:00 |
Frank Karlitschek
|
f50be25704
|
Merge pull request #1864 from owncloud/fix_display_default
LDAP: simplify default for user home settings, fixes wrong display of de...
|
2013-02-25 08:23:32 -08:00 |
Arthur Schiwon
|
e4e915fa3b
|
LDAP: simplify default for user home settings, fixes wrong display of default value in settings
|
2013-02-22 21:26:07 +01:00 |
Bart Visscher
|
bb75dfc021
|
Whitespace fixes
|
2013-02-22 19:05:36 +01:00 |
Bernhard Posselt
|
90939c8f12
|
Merge pull request #1708 from owncloud/style-cleanup-user_ldap
Style cleanup user_ldap
|
2013-02-17 07:02:45 -08:00 |
Arthur Schiwon
|
a28df74ee5
|
LDAP: check array with isset first to avoid warnings about undefined index
|
2013-02-16 02:33:19 +01:00 |
Bart Visscher
|
92a36ca8b8
|
Join short comment lines
|
2013-02-15 15:45:34 +01:00 |
Bart Visscher
|
1ef2ecd6e8
|
Style cleanup user_ldap
|
2013-02-14 22:16:48 +01:00 |
Bart Visscher
|
cd35d257bb
|
Fix NoSpaceAfterComma and SpaceBeforeComma
|
2013-02-14 08:36:26 +01:00 |
Bart Visscher
|
5c4a804ddb
|
Fix SpaceBeforeOpenBrace errors
|
2013-02-14 08:36:26 +01:00 |
Arthur Schiwon
|
1e45453da2
|
LDAP: format dn before using it, not other way round. fixes #1605
|
2013-02-13 14:49:18 +01:00 |
blizzz
|
b6ee118841
|
Merge pull request #1604 from owncloud/fix_ldap_internalname_generation
Improve generation of interal user names resp. group display names
|
2013-02-12 03:37:40 -08:00 |
Arthur Schiwon
|
afc9fe419a
|
adjust copyright
|
2013-02-10 21:53:27 +01:00 |
Arthur Schiwon
|
dbb4be903c
|
LDAP: change generation of internal names. Use UUID for users. Change to sequential numbers for groups as they are still used as display names
|
2013-02-10 21:52:57 +01:00 |
Frank Karlitschek
|
764409117a
|
Merge pull request #1493 from owncloud/fix_ldap_stored_homedir
Fix ldap stored homedir
|
2013-02-11 02:20:03 -08:00 |
Arthur Schiwon
|
15e383fd01
|
Typo
|
2013-02-07 16:05:45 +01:00 |
Arthur Schiwon
|
781d247b39
|
LDAP: better detect timeouts. do not try to reconnect. do not try to bind when connection failed. makes ownCloud more responsive, esp. with multiple server connections configured
|
2013-02-06 14:32:00 +01:00 |
Arthur Schiwon
|
e122fdbcb6
|
LDAP: when ldaps and tls are configured, disable the latter one - they do not work together. ldaps already creates a secure connection.
|
2013-02-06 14:30:17 +01:00 |
Arthur Schiwon
|
af2acadc66
|
LDAP: fix settings handling of homeFolderNamingRule option
|
2013-02-06 13:04:35 +01:00 |
Arthur Schiwon
|
afacaf8bc2
|
string fragment was added by accident and does not belong here
|
2013-01-31 18:00:07 +01:00 |
Thomas Mueller
|
19714151e2
|
spell check
|
2013-01-31 17:53:01 +01:00 |
Thomas Mueller
|
5862f3d140
|
spell check
|
2013-01-31 17:51:59 +01:00 |
Arthur Schiwon
|
1a854454d6
|
LDAP: avoid attempts to save null as configvalue
|
2013-01-31 02:00:29 +01:00 |